Mykonos island has two ports. The new one is located in Tourlos district just 3,5 KM from Mykonos town, and the old port which is very close to the town of Mykonos. So, this can be mind confusing but have no worries! We are here to help! The New Port (Tourlos) is the main port of Mykonos and operates exclusively the typical passenger ferries and cruise ships. It is located 3 km north of Mykonos Town. So, whether you are travelling from Athens ports (Piraeus, Rafina, or Lavrio) or another island on a typical passenger ferry, or cruise ship you will arrive at, or depart from the New Mykonos Port (Tourlos). The old port in Mykonos is located in Mykonos town (Chora) and it operated as the main port for ferries till 20 years ago. Recently, it has been used by some fishermen and yachts.
Mykonos Town
  • 1h 30m
The town is a Cycladic village built amphitheatrically, also known as Chora following the common practice in Greece when the name of the island itself is the same as the name of the principal town. A great number of bars and nightclubs can be found in the capital, proving that the fame of Mykonos to be a party island is not just fame, it is a fact. It has whitewashed cubic houses with wooden coloured doors, windows, and balconies, narrow streets forming a labyrinth. Numerous cafes, chic boutiques, souvenir shops, and fine jewellery shops are helping visitors to enjoy their days in the beautiful capital. Worth seeing in Town is the church complex of Panagia Paraportiani, the famous whitewashed windmills, trademark of the island, the Little Venice which is one of the most beautiful parts of the capital, and the scene forms a wonderful and unique image that charms everyone by its incredible beauty and its magical atmosphere. Another trademark of the island is Petros the pelican.
Agios Ioannis Beach
  • 30m
Agios Ioannis is a small tourist village in the southwest of the island, 2.5 km from Ornos. It is built amphitheatrically and located across from Delos, combining natural beauty with excellent tourist accommodation. Pink and purple flowers drape the stairways and balconies of the white houses. The lovely sandy beach of Agios Ioannis with crystal clean waters took its name from the church that is located here. The beach is recommended for those who want peace and relaxation. You'll also find a plethora of diverse restaurants, taverns with tasty Greek food, and abundant opportunities for water sports, ranging from scuba diving to surfing in turquoise waters. Close proximity to the nearby villages allows for opportunities to traverse the streets, admire the classical architecture, or enjoy a picturesque view of the nearby Delos Island. Scenes from the 1989 film 'Shirley Valentine' were filmed in Agios Ioannis.
Delos
  • 10m
As you are in Ag. Ioannis you will have now the chance to admire the famous island of Delos. Delos is a Greek island and archaeological site in the Aegean Sea's Cyclades archipelago, opposite Mykonos island. The mythological birthplace of Apollo and Artemis was a major religious centre and port during the 1st millennium B.C. The island's ruins encompass Doric temples, a synagoque, markets, an amphitheatre, houses with mosaics, and the iconic Terrace of the Lions statues. The Archaeological Museum displays statues excavated from the site. The entire island is designated as an archaeological site, to be precise, a UNESCO world heritage site. Faros Armenistis
  • 1h
Both a testimony to Mykonos' maritime history and a fully functioning lighthouse, the landmark is a must-see! At the location of "Fanari" which translates to "lantern" in Greek, the scenic coastal road also offers some of the most spectacular views on the island just 7 km from Chora. The Lighthouse of Armenistis (Faros Armenistis) was built in 1891, following the sinking of an English steamship off the island’s coasts. The Lighthouse became a famous attraction because of its imposing presence and its award-winning mechanism, at the Paris Internationa Expo. Today, this mechanism is kept at the Aegean Maritime Museum, located in city centre Mykonos, in the Tria Pigadia area. You can also visit the Armenistis area where the Lighthouse is located and enjoy the unique view of the neighbouring island of Tinos.

Monastery of Panayia Tourliani
  • 15m
  • Admission ticket not included
The Byzantine monastery of Panagia Tourliani is located almost in the heart of the island, just 8 km from the capital of Mykonos, Chora. See the historic monastery of Panagia Tourliani, one of the main attractions of the whole island, built in the 15th century. The all-white monastery is located right in front of the main square of the village. The honour in the face of the Virgin Mary is special and is at the heart of the religiousness of the pious Mykonians, as is the case in the rest of the Cycladic islands. The Soul of the Mykonians is located in Panagia Tourliani, the patron saint of this island, and its historical monastery. The historic monastery of Panagia Tourliani, which is the religious creed of Mykonians and the protector of the island, was founded in 1542.

Our proposal; Elia Beach is the largest on the island, providing comfortable sunbeds, water sports, and beach bars and restaurants. Protected from the northern summer winds and with views of Naxos Island, Elia is a sandy and eventful beach. For your comfort, there are separate nudist and gay areas.

If you choose you can even swim here as it is one of the most beautiful beaches on Mykonos island! Kalafatis Beach is a long sandy strip under a clear blue sky. It is considered one of the largest beaches on the island popular for families with children and with those who enjoy water sports, especially windsurfing. Water skiing, jet skiing, standup paddleboarding, snorkelling, diving, etc. are available for visitors. As it’s away from the more touristy beaches, it remains less developed, but it has a few hotels and restaurants. Kalafatis is equipped with umbrellas and deck chairs which you can rent for a small price. There are hotels and villas of various prices, mini-markets, taverns, and cafes with fresh seafood all around the beach and its outskirts.
